What it the present, past, future of the verb?
Verb Present Past Future
sit
worry

Respuesta :

assiahmedicinecrow
assiahmedicinecrow assiahmedicinecrow
  • 04-02-2021

Answer:Present Tense: sit, sits

Past Tense: sat

Future Tense: will sit

Present Tense: worry, worries

Past Tense: worried

Future Tense: will worry
